How do I convert 55,736 Wh to mAh?

Use the formula: mAh = Wh × 1,000 / V. At 3.7V: 55,736 × 1,000 / 3.7 = 15,063,783.7799999993 mAh.

Does 55,736 Wh equal the same mAh at every voltage?

No. Higher voltage means fewer mAh for the same Wh. Use the calculator above to try different voltages.
